- freefilesync: Cross-platform file sync utility with GUI (GPL release)
FreeFileSync is a folder comparison and synchronization software that
creates and manages backup copies of all your important files. Instead
of copying every file every time, FreeFileSync determines the
differences between a source and a target folder and transfers only the
minimum amount of data needed. FreeFileSync is Open Source software,
available for Windows, Linux and macOS.
.
This is the "GPL release" which uses the sources as published by the author,
as opposed to the "FreeFileSync Donation Edition".
